What does a remote DevOps engineer intern do?

A Remote DevOps Engineer Intern assists in developing, deploying, and maintaining software infrastructure from a remote location. Their responsibilities often include automating processes, supporting CI/CD pipelines, monitoring system performance, and collaborating with development and operations teams to ensure efficient software delivery. Interns typically work with cloud platforms, scripting languages, and various DevOps tools, while learning industry best practices. This position provides hands-on experience in modern software engineering workflows and fosters collaboration skills in a distributed work environment.

What are some common challenges faced by remote DevOps engineer interns, and how can they overcome them?

Remote DevOps Engineer Interns often encounter challenges such as effective communication across distributed teams, managing time zone differences, and gaining hands-on experience with complex infrastructure. To overcome these, interns should proactively participate in team meetings, utilize collaboration tools like Slack and Jira, and seek regular feedback from mentors. Additionally, setting a structured daily routine and leveraging cloud-based sandbox environments for practice can help interns build skills and stay engaged while working remotely.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ote DevOps engineer int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ote DevOps Engineer Intern, you need a foundational understanding of software development, system administration, and networking, often supported by coursework or relevant technical experience. Familiarity with tools like Git, Docker, Jenkins, cloud platforms (AWS, Azure, or GCP), and basic scripting (Python, Bash) is typically expected. Strong problem-solving skills, effective communication, and the ability to work independently are standout soft skills for remote collaboration. These competencies are crucial for ensuring efficient software deployment, maintaining reliable systems, and contributing to team productivity from a remote setting.

What is the difference between Remote Devops Engineer Intern vs Remote Cloud Engineer Intern?

AspectRemote Devops Engineer InternRemote Cloud Engineer Intern
Required CredentialsBasic knowledge of DevOps tools, some certifications preferredKnowledge of cloud platforms, certifications like AWS or Azure beneficial
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with DevOps teams, focuses on automation and CI/CDWorks with cloud infrastructure, deployment, and management
Industry UsageUsed in companies emphasizing continuous integration and deploymentCommon in organizations migrating to or managing cloud services

The Remote Devops Engineer Intern and Remote Cloud Engineer Intern roles share overlapping skills in cloud platforms and automation tools. However, DevOps interns focus more on automation pipelines and integration, while Cloud interns concentrate on cloud infrastructure management. Both roles are entry-level, remote, and industry-relevant, but they target different aspects of technology deployment and management.

The Role
You will build, operate, and scale automated, testable, and auditable network infrastructure using software engineering practices.
Key responsibilities include:
  • Design, develop, and maintain Infrastructure-as-Code (IaC) to provision and manage network devices, services, and configurations.
  • Build and own GitLab CI/CD pipelines for network automation, validation, and deployment.
  • Develop automation and orchestration tooling using Python, Ansible, and Terraform.
  • Implement automated testing (unit, integration, and device/system-level) for network changes - e.g., PyATS or equivalent.
  • Create and maintain reusable automation libraries, templates, and modules for multi-vendor environments.
  • Integrate network automation with inventory/CMDB systems (e.g., ServiceNow), monitoring, and ITSM.
  • Troubleshoot production network and automation issues; perform root cause analysis and corrective automation.
  • Author and maintain runbooks, design docs, and change control artifacts that support safe, auditable deployments.
  • Participate in cross-functional projects: Network modernization, SD-WAN rollouts, PCI and security controls, site onboarding.
  • Coach and mentor other engineers on automation best practices, testing, and Git-based workflows.
